๐ช
Freedom Firearms LLC
Freedom Firearms Llc ยท 37-019-01-04075
As Listed On
GunzDepot
โ
โ
โ
โ
โ
โ (0 reviews)
๐
Address
1216 Cr 3300n
Rantoul, IL 61866
Rantoul, IL 61866
๐
Hours
Contact for hours
Services
Transfers
Reviews (0)
Write a Review๐
No reviews yet. Be the first to leave one!